Construction sites face numerous challenges when it comes to protecting materials, equipment, and work areas from harsh weather conditions. Among the various protective solutions available, the 4x4 tarpaulin size stands out as the optimal choice for construction applications. This versatile covering solution offers the perfect balance of manageability, coverage area, and durability that construction professionals demand. The 4x4 meter dimension provides approximately 16 square meters of coverage, making it substantial enough to protect significant amounts of materials while remaining lightweight and easy to handle by construction crews. Unlike larger tarpaulins that require multiple workers to deploy, or smaller ones that offer insufficient coverage, the 4x4 tarpaulin size delivers practical functionality that enhances productivity on construction sites. These tarpaulins are engineered with high-density polyethylene materials and advanced coating technologies that ensure reliable protection against rain, UV radiation, wind, and debris, making them indispensable tools for modern construction operations.

Perfect Size and Manageability for Construction Teams

tarpaulin​​​​​​​Optimal Coverage Area for Construction Materials

The 4x4 tarpaulin size provides an ideal coverage area of 16 square meters, which perfectly matches the storage and protection needs of most construction materials. This dimension is specifically suited for covering lumber stacks, cement bags, steel reinforcement materials, and construction tools without creating excessive overhang that could catch wind or create tripping hazards. Construction managers consistently report that this size eliminates the common problems associated with oversized tarps, such as difficulty in securing edges and increased wind resistance. The 16 square meter coverage area efficiently protects valuable materials from moisture damage, which can compromise structural integrity and lead to costly project delays. When covering lumber, the 4x4 tarpaulin size accommodates standard stack dimensions while providing adequate edge protection to prevent water infiltration. For cement and dry materials, this size creates an effective moisture barrier that prevents hydration and spoilage. The dimensions also work exceptionally well for protecting smaller equipment and tool storage areas, creating organized and protected work zones that improve overall site efficiency and material management.

Easy Handling and Quick Deployment

Construction teams require protective solutions that can be deployed rapidly without disrupting workflow productivity. The 4x4 tarpaulin size strikes the perfect balance between coverage and handling ease, typically requiring only two workers for efficient deployment and securing. This manageable size reduces the time investment needed for material protection, allowing crews to focus on primary construction activities. The polyethylene construction with LDPE coating creates a lightweight yet durable solution that doesn't strain workers during installation or removal procedures. Unlike larger tarpaulins that require specialized equipment or multiple crew members, the 4x4 tarpaulin size can be easily folded, transported, and stored when not in use. Quick deployment capabilities become particularly crucial during unexpected weather changes, where rapid material protection can prevent thousands of dollars in damage. The reinforced edges and grommets positioned at regular intervals facilitate secure fastening with bungee cords, ropes, or tie-downs without requiring extensive setup time. This efficiency improvement translates directly into cost savings and improved project timelines, making the 4x4 tarpaulin size a strategic investment for construction operations.

Versatile Applications and Professional Features

Multi-Purpose Construction Site Applications

The 4x4 tarpaulin size excels in numerous construction site applications beyond basic material protection, demonstrating remarkable versatility that enhances overall project efficiency. Construction teams utilize these tarps for creating temporary work shelters, protecting freshly poured concrete from weather interference, and establishing dust control barriers during demolition or cutting operations. The dimensions work perfectly for truck bed covers, protecting materials during transportation between job sites and preventing loss or weather damage during transit. Ground protection applications include creating clean work surfaces over muddy or uneven terrain, preventing soil contamination from construction materials, and establishing staging areas for equipment and supplies. The 4x4 tarpaulin size also serves effectively as debris containment during renovation projects, preventing material spread to surrounding areas and facilitating cleanup operations. Temporary roofing applications benefit from this size when covering damaged roof sections or creating weather protection during roofing installations. The versatility extends to creating privacy screens around construction sites, protecting ongoing work from public view while maintaining professional project appearance. These multiple applications provide exceptional value by reducing the need for specialized protective equipment and enabling construction teams to address various protection needs with a single, reliable solution.
